A Simple Key For secure coding practices Unveiled

Prompt optimization: By optimizing the prompts builders can explicitly ask for code that takes advantage of tricks administration. This may lead on the LLMs making code that follows this greatest observe.

Like injection attacks, buffer overflows also permit an exterior attacker to ‘set’ code or data into a technique. If completed the right way, it opens up that procedure to even more Guidelines from the skin.

Men and women just learning the way to code will see Java an excellent language to start out and use like a stepping stone towards other languages.

It should be famous that the following sections will extremely briefly touch on actions coated in Each individual phase of SDLC. This is often not at all an entire list of pursuits that could be carried out.

Build your software security prerequisites early and sit within the shade of securely built software afterwards.

In security, exactly the same types of thoughts exist. What types of vulnerabilities are you looking to avoid? How will you measure no matter whether your requirement is achieved? What preventative measures will you're taking to make certain vulnerabilities aren’t built in the code by itself?

Given that the design/architecture was done in a sdlc information security detailed and arranged manner, code technology may be completed without the need of lots of logistical hurdles.

It is best to tailor generic advice from industry greatest practices and regulatory specifications to satisfy precise application prerequisites.

Product threats. Use menace modeling to anticipate the threats to building secure software which the software is going to be subjected. Danger modeling includes identifying crucial assets, decomposing the application, identifying and categorizing the threats to each asset or component, score the threats based upon a danger ranking, after which producing threat mitigation techniques that are applied in designs, code, and take a look at security in software development situations [Swiderski 04].

Learn the way to include security practices into your code and discover security vulnerabilities earlier in development. Sign-up for the no cost seven-working day demo.

It’s crucial that builders Keep to the coding tips as defined by their organization and system-unique instruments, such as the compilers, interpreters, and debuggers which are used to streamline the code technology course of action.

Microsoft's Security Development Lifecycle (SDL) can be a security assurance approach focused on producing and running secure software. The SDL supplies specific, measurable security needs for builders and engineers at Microsoft to lessen the selection and severity of vulnerabilities within our products and services.

Are you currently curious concerning how you will discover Software Development Security Best Practices and secure programming practices mitigate your vulnerabilities using OWASP? Have a look at our website write-up on the topic or Get hold of us for more information on our security screening products and services.

Most software code can simply utilize the infrastructure carried out by .Web. In some instances, additional application-distinct security is needed, built possibly by extending the security procedure or through the use of new advert hoc procedures.

Leave a Reply

Your email address will not be published. Required fields are marked *